A group of loyal donors to Madison Public Library Foundation is offering a $100,000 match throughout December for all gifts made to the annual fund, which fuels core library resources and programming. Every contribution will go twice as far!

In 2023, annual fund gifts supported:

  • collection items – books, large-print books, Spanish-language picture books, music, moves, and even seed libraries
  • programs, including Library Takeover and Live Well @ Your Library
  • technology – computers, Wi-Fi, and audiovisual upgrades in meeting rooms at many libraries
  • AASPIRE internships (Affirmative Action Student Professionals in Residence) for students of color and others from underrepresented groups as part of the foundation’s Equity and Innovation funding initiative
  • library staff training and professional development
  • sewing machines for Sequoya Library classes
  • the library staff’s BIPOC and Pride Affinity Groups
  • lecterns for Central Library events, such as Wisconsin Book Festival free author programming

You can expect the foundation to fund many more critical library services and materials in 2024, in addition to reserving 10 percent of annual fund proceeds for the permanent endowment, which sustains the library for the future.
